Output fd884c255ee4619a50a537e6cfc542167f39c192e30bc70a57662227f049ecc6:126

value
5335
script pubkey
OP_0 OP_PUSHBYTES_20 afa3f75d5406d1d82128ad307a331878884bf91e
address
bc1q473lwh25qmgasgfg45c85vcc0zyyh7g70jh0p7
transaction
fd884c255ee4619a50a537e6cfc542167f39c192e30bc70a57662227f049ecc6
confirmations
195086
spent
true